Hamid Karzai calls for dialogue between Panjshir resistance forces and Taliban

Afghanistan's former President Hamid Karzai has called for dialogue between Panjshir resistance forces and Taliban, Report informs, citing Khaama Press.
"I am concerned about the clashes. I urge both parties to settle their problems through dialogue," Karzai said.
Resistance forces led by Ahmad Massoud and Afghanistan's first vice president, Amirullah Saleh, have gathered in Panjshir to resist the Taliban, which seized power in the country.
